Code Ann. § 8-3-202","heading":"Definitions","body":"As used in this subchapter:\n\n(1) \"Covered electric generating unit\" means an existing fossil-fuel-fired electric generating unit within the state that is subject to regulation under federal emission guidelines;\n\n(2) \"Federal emission guidelines\" means a final rule, regulation, guideline, or other requirement that the United States Environmental Protection Agency may adopt for regulating carbon dioxide emissions from covered electric generating units under § 111(d) of the Clean Air Act, 42 U.S.C. § 7411(d) ; and\n\n(3) \"State plan\" means a plan to establish and enforce carbon dioxide emission control measures that the Division of Environmental Quality may adopt to implement the obligations of the state under the federal emission guidelines.","path":["AR Code","Title 8","Chapter 3","Subchapter 2"],"source_url":"https://oss-data-us.vaquill.ai/v2026.08/us_ar_statutes.parquet","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:41Z","sha256":"72d71d16147467d924188481730ea8147b11356968e0041ca9d17f46e0850bd4","source_id":"us-ar","stale":false,"prev":"us-ar/ark.-code-ann.-8-3-201","next":"us-ar/ark.-code-ann.-8-3-203"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
